Eaton CVS3175Y3 Molded Case Circuit Breaker - 42 kAIC

CVS3175Y3 Eaton: Eaton Type CV Molded Case Circuit Breaker,Molded case circuit breaker,175 A,42 kAIC,Three-pole,#6 - 4/0 Al/Cu,CV,#300 kcmil maximum line

Catalog Notes
#300 kcmil options use a terminal shield and add 1.50 inches (38.1 mm) to the length of the breaker
